Book News: Little Black Dress April Releases
Little Black Dress are releasing three novels in April. All three come out on April 2nd. Here are the covers and blurbs. Tomorrow… all the books out in April from all the other publishers.
SUSAN CONLEY - THE FIDELITY PROJECT
Jacinta Quirke and Maxine O’Malley, a.k.a. Jax and Max, need a plan, fast. They’ve just heard rumours that they are about to lose their jobs at advertising agency ACJ in Dublin. Could they make it in the (supposedly) more lucrative world of TV?
Their proposal: a documentary on fidelity. Is long-term monogamy a sham as cynical Max believes? Or will Jax, the hopeless romantic, prove her wrong. Putting a variety of couples into the hot seat, they get the cameras rolling. But when they turn on each other’s love-lives, the trouble really starts…
Friendship, passion and fidelity – nothing’s ever simple when it comes to love.
NIAMH SHAW - SMART CASUAL
Olivia Smith is stuck in a rut. Working nine-to-five in a dreary The Office-style company, her only hope is to scale the corporate ladder, and fast.
Lucky this new employee who’s apparently starting soon, Luke Wylie, is coming along to help out, eh?
Well, it would be, except that Olivia’s got it wrong (again) and Luke actually turns out to be her new boss.
She’ll never forgive him. Ever. Except… he is completely gorgeous, and he does seem to be making a massive effort to win her over…
Find out if Olivia’s made to be a lover or a hater in this gorgeous, fast and funny read!
TARRAS WILDING - LEOPARD ROCK
Rumour and romance get all stirred up in a fabulous read from the heart of the African outback
Roo Beckett knew there had to be a catch when she won first prize in a prestigious wildlife fim-making competition. A month’s mentorship in the beautiful South African game reserve, Leopard Rock, with renowened film-maker Wyk Kruger, seemed simply too good to be true.
Sure enough, after her free-loading, fashion-magazine colleagues decide to tag along, Roo’s solo African adventure doesn’t have the best of starts. But that’s the least of her worries. Lost in the African outback, Roo’s soon struggling with a bigger and more unexpected problem - her attraction to the mysterious Wyk himself…
